Has anyone had any experiences using HIPP organic comfort for colic and constipation?

My little man is 5 weeks and I've had to change him from aptimil to HIPP. Massive improvement as he has a rash, constipated with an upset tummy and was being sick, to now extremely constipated with play dough like stools! He is super uncomfortable and can't go into a deep enough sleep.

Been to see the GP and they have given me a movicol laxative... if this doesn't work they are going to refer to allergy clinic. In the mean time.... I'm thinking to change from HIPP organic 1 milk that he has been on for the past 5 days, to HIPP Comfort - so the same milk just one designed to help colic and constipation.

Has anyone had any similar experiences? If so please do let me know! I'm not sure whether to hold fire and stick with the original HIPP for a little longer or just change to the comfort? Hate seeing him in pain!

Has anyone mentioned the possibility of Cow's Milk Protein Allergy (CMPA) OP?

dementedpixie · 15/08/2019 09:17

Play dough consistency doesn't sound like constipation. Stools are dry and hard if constipated

Hairwizard · 17/08/2019 15:24

I tried that with my dd last yr, as thought same. I found it made hers runnier and mucusy. And didnt like consistency of the formula. Noticed it would split when left sitting for a bit so wouldnt have put in fridge for later use.

Rhi11 · 18/08/2019 09:41

Sounds like cmpa . We went through this . You can get formula for cmpa on prescription. We do. Just a heads up our lo hates the taste still brestfeeding because of this. Just had to change to a dairy free diet.
